Summary:
Very nice CD-radio, Very clear sound, DSP lacks some functions (main speakers (Front/rear) delays), No CD-Text without Changer (i cant believe this), nice looking, center speaker is very good, 6-volt preouts and subout..

Strengths:
Center Speaker DSP / EQ Very clear sound Remote Control

Weaknesses:
No CD-text Little confusing to use (at first)

Summary:
Not for competition use. If you're putting together a total multi-media system, this might be the one for you. Again, very complicated to use for everyday listening.

Strengths:
Built-in DSP. Digital display is a light show!!! After you earn your bachelor of science degree at Panasonic University, you'll have a blast with all the gadgets on this one.

Weaknesses:
Very complicated unit to use. Keep your owners' manual at hand at all times. It will take you atleast a week to figure out how to adjust everything on this radio.
